​Part-time work for a teenage child is not a bad thing. Kori Ellis says, "Having a job outside the home helps teach childre about hard work, responsibilty, time management, honesty, teamwork and the value of money. When a child has to earn their own money, the money's worth to them increases greatly. Jobs that are acceptable are great experiences that teach children about the real world.

Philanthropy is also important. It shows children that money is not the only incentive for hard work. Helping others is great way to donate time and effort. Local charities, church activities and other groups/ organizations always welcome helping hands.
